Strategies for Enhancing Financial Literacy and Building a Robust Portfolio

Improving financial literacy is essential for anyone looking to create and sustain wealth. To begin, mastering the art of budgeting is critical. A well-structured budget allows individuals to track their income and expenses, helping them identify areas for savings. It is advisable to categorize expenditures into fixed, variable, and discretionary categories, which can provide insights into one’s spending habits. Using budgeting tools, whether digital apps or traditional spreadsheets, can simplify this process.

Equally important is the understanding of credit scores. Knowledge of how credit scores are calculated and the factors that influence them can empower individuals to maintain good credit, which is crucial for qualifying for loans and mortgages. Regularly reviewing credit reports and addressing any discrepancies can significantly impact one’s financial status. Moreover, it’s also essential to be aware of how credit utilization, payment history, and types of credit can affect one’s score.

Investing basics form a cornerstone of financial literacy. Understanding various investment vehicles such as stocks, bonds, and mutual funds is critical when building a portfolio. Diversification is equally vital; spreading investments across different asset classes can mitigate risks and optimize returns. Familiarizing oneself with the principles of risk tolerance and market research can greatly enhance investment decisions.
